PESHAWAR:

The 26th death anniversary of the Pashto poet, Ghani Khan, was marked at his native town in Charsadda on Thursday.

The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Culture and Tourism Authority (KPCTA) had arranged the ceremony at Ghani Khan Dheri in Charsadda - the final abode of the poet.

Ghani Khan was also known as the ‘Lunatic Philosopher’ for his unique style, poetic depth, individuality, diversity and transcending imagination the matchlessness traits only owned by him.

Professor Abseen Yousfazai said that Ghani Khan suffered great hardships, including rigorous imprisonment while opposing British imperialism.

He said Ghani Khan stood like a rock and used the power of pen to raise awareness among his people about the freedom from the colonial power.

He termed Ghani Khan a great literary giant among his contemporaries due to his lofty imagination and creative vision tinged with a carefree nature and deep love for beauty and art.
